Panasonic Lumix DMC-FX500 Review
The Panasonic DMC-FX500 is a new 10 megapixel compact camera with an official price of £330 / $399. Sure, you can find it cheaper if you shop around online, but why such a lot for what is just a 10 megapixel camera? The answers lie within the stylish and diminutive metal shell of the FX500. A 25-125mm, 5x optical zoom lens, innovative touch-screen interface, 720p high-definition movies, and full range of creative exposure modes all add up to make this one of the most unique compacts available today. And it’s not very often, in a year of copy-cat cameras, that we get to say that. Mark Goldstein finds out if the new Panasonic Lumix DMC-FX500 can live up to its impressive specification…
